3. INTRODUCTION
Department of Electrical and Electronics Engineering
A bio-battery is an energy storing
device that is powered by organic
compounds.
Bio battery use biocatalyst, either
biomolecules such as enzymes or even
whole living organism to catalyze
oxidation of bio mass-based materials
for generating electrical energy.
7. MERITS
Instant recharge
Eco friendly
Raw materials available easily & plenty
Portable & light weight compared to fuel cell.
Provide a better employment scope for rural areas.
readily available fuel source.

APPLICATION
Used as portable charging in cell phones, soldier
power etc.
Used in medical implants e.g. pace makers, insulin
pumps etc.
Used in disaster relief e.g. generators, remote power
etc.
It is also used in toys and greeting cards.
